5 Eastgate House is a stunning, three-bedroom garden apartment within this handsome Grade II listed, Georgian property conveniently located in the centre of Warwick. Occupying a prominent position on Jury Street, Eastgate House is just moments from Warwick Castle, St. Nicholas Park and the mainline train station. The apartment is also within easy reach of local shops, bars and restaurants, schools and the motorway network.LocationAs its name suggests, Eastgate House stands opposite the ancient Eastgate which provided the approach to the historic town centre. A wide variety of shops and restaurants are nearby as is the medieval Warwick Castle and grounds. Warwick enjoys various shopping, caf?s, restaurants, and recreational facilities. Commuting is easy, with regular trains from nearby Warwick Station, Warwick Parkway and Leamington Spa to London Marylebone (fastest trains under 90 minutes) and Birmingham.
